gsrc-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Gsrc-commit] trunk r4784: update gcc to 7.2.0


From: Carl Hansen
Subject: [Gsrc-commit] trunk r4784: update gcc to 7.2.0
Date: Fri, 29 Sep 2017 03:52:53 -0400 (EDT)
User-agent: Bazaar (2.7.0dev1)

------------------------------------------------------------
revno: 4784
revision-id: address@hidden
parent: address@hidden
committer: address@hidden
branch nick: trunk
timestamp: Fri 2017-09-29 00:52:49 -0700
message:
  update gcc to 7.2.0
modified:
  pkg/gnu/gcc/Makefile           makefile-20160617014725-uokjfnggs70iry9h-679
  pkg/gnu/gcc/config.mk          config.mk-20160617015453-ksaie5ols1c2eidw-1
=== modified file 'pkg/gnu/gcc/Makefile'
--- a/pkg/gnu/gcc/Makefile      2017-09-13 19:50:37 +0000
+++ b/pkg/gnu/gcc/Makefile      2017-09-29 07:52:49 +0000
@@ -36,9 +36,11 @@
 DISTFILES = $(DISTNAME).tar.xz
 SIGFILES =  $(DISTNAME).tar.xz.sig
 
+WORKSRC = $(WORKDIR)/$(DISTNAME)
 WORKOBJ = $(WORKDIR)/$(DISTNAME).build
-INSTALL_SCRIPTS = $(WORKOBJ)/Makefile 
-#links
+# CONFIGURE_SCRIPTS = reallyconfigure
+BUILD_SCRIPTS = reallybuild
+INSTALL_SCRIPTS = $(WORKOBJ)/Makefile links
 INFO_FILES = cpp.info  cppinternals.info  cp-tools.info  gccgo.info  gcc.info  
\
                         gccinstall.info  gccint.info  gcj.info  gfortran.info  
gnat_rm.info  \
                         gnat-style.info gnat_ugn.info  libgomp.info  
libitm.info  \
@@ -60,14 +62,23 @@
                 --with-system-zlib      \
          --with-target-bdw-gc=$(prefix) 
 
-CPPFLAGS += -I$(prefix)/include
+CPPFLAGS += -I$(prefix)/include 
 
 include ../../../gar/gar.lib/auto.mk
 include ../../../gar/gar.lib/info.mk
 include config.mk
 
-post-build: build
-       make -C $(WORKOBJ) all
+# configure in WORKSRC, is that right?
+#configure-reallyconfigure:
+#      @printf "[$(OK)really configure$(OFF)] $(MSG)Running $(CONFIGURE_NAME) 
in $(OFF)$*\n"
+#      mkdir -p $(WORKOBJ)
+#      #cd $(WORKSRC) && $(CONFIGURE_ENV) $(WORKSRC)/$(CONFIGURE_NAME) 
$(CONFIGURE_ARGS) $(OUTPUT)
+#      cd $(WORKOBJ) && $(MAKE) configure
+#      $(MAKECOOKIE)
+
+build-reallybuild:
+       @printf "[$(OK)reallybuild$(OFF)] $(MSG)Running reallybuild in 
$(OFF)$*\n"
+       cd $(WORKOBJ)  &&  $(MAKE) all
        $(MAKECOOKIE)
 
 install-links:

=== modified file 'pkg/gnu/gcc/config.mk'
--- a/pkg/gnu/gcc/config.mk     2017-05-02 20:25:39 +0000
+++ b/pkg/gnu/gcc/config.mk     2017-09-29 07:52:49 +0000
@@ -9,7 +9,7 @@
 ## gnat (ada) is a special case;  requires a working ada compiler to
 ## already be installed, the compiler you are using to compile the rest.
 
-# --enable-languages=c,c++,fortran,go,lto,objc,obj-c++,ada 
+# --enable-languages=c,c++,fortran,go,lto,objc,obj-c++,ada,brig
 
 # --enable-languages=jit 
 # jit requires --enable-host-shared
@@ -32,7 +32,7 @@
 --enable-default-pie \
 --enable-gnu-unique-object \
 --enable-gtk-cairo \
---enable-languages=c,c++,fortran,go,lto,objc,obj-c++,ada \
+--enable-languages=c,c++,fortran,go,lto,objc,obj-c++,ada,brig \
 --enable-libada \
 --enable-libmpx \
 --enable-libssp \


reply via email to

[Prev in Thread] Current Thread [Next in Thread]